The global heart valve devices market is set to witness substantial growth in the coming years, driven by increasing incidences of cardiovascular diseases, technological innovations, and the growing acceptance of minimally invasive cardiac procedures. Heart valve devices, including mechanical valves, biological valves, and transcatheter valves, have become essential tools in treating valvular heart diseases, particularly among the elderly population. The market forecast reflects an optimistic outlook, with rising demand across both developed and emerging regions, accompanied by significant product development and healthcare infrastructure advancements.

2. Surge in Minimally Invasive Procedures

Minimally invasive heart valve procedures, especially Transcatheter Aortic Valve Replacement (TAVR) and Transcatheter Mitral Valve Repair (TMVR), are forecasted to witness exponential growth over the next several years. These procedures are preferred due to lower surgical risks, shorter hospital stays, and quicker recovery times compared to traditional open-heart surgeries. Market expansion is expected as regulatory authorities approve transcatheter therapies for broader patient populations, including intermediate and low-risk groups.

3. Technological Innovation Driving New Product Development

The market forecast reflects significant contributions from ongoing research and development, with next-generation heart valve devices expected to improve patient outcomes, device durability, and procedural success rates. Innovations such as tissue-engineered valves, enhanced biological valve materials, and repositionable transcatheter devices are projected to gain widespread adoption. The integration of digital health technologies and artificial intelligence (AI) for procedural planning and post-operative monitoring will further enhance the efficiency and safety of heart valve interventions.
